Signs You Might Have an Opossum Problem

These signs are common indicators:

  • Scratching or thumping sounds at night (especially in walls or attics)
  • Overturned garbage cans or pet food dishes
  • Foul odors coming from under your deck, shed, or crawlspace
  • Droppings that resemble those of a cat, but with more variation
  • Sightings of a slow-moving, grayish animal with a long tail

Frequently Asked Questions on Opossum Removal in Commerce Township

1. What should I do if I see an opossum in my yard in Commerce Township?

  • If the opossum is not showing signs of aggression or illness and isn’t causing damage, you can observe from a distance—opossums are generally harmless. However, if it keeps returning or enters your attic, garage, or crawl space, it’s best to call a licensed wildlife removal expert.

2. Can opossums damage my home?

  • Yes. Opossums can rip up insulation, chew through ductwork, and leave behind waste that causes odors and health hazards. They’re especially problematic when they make a nest in attics, under porches, or inside crawl spaces.

3. Is it legal to trap and relocate opossums in Michigan?

  • Only licensed professionals can legally trap and relocate opossums in Michigan. DIY trapping without the proper permits can be illegal and inhumane.

5. How can I keep opossums away from my property?

  • You can discourage opossums by securing trash bins, removing pet food at night, trimming low-hanging branches, and sealing entry points around your home. But for long-term prevention, a professional exclusion service is the most effective solution.
